The course is for class 11 Arts/Commerce as per the guidelines of PSEB.
Time Allowed: 3 Hours
Theory: 80 Marks
Project Work: 20 Marks
Total: 100 Marks
Examination pattern :
There will be 15 Questions in all. All Questions will be compulsory. (Use of simple calculator will be allowed for Numerical questions)
Section A.
Question No. 1 will consist of 11 subparts (a to k) carrying 1 mark each. Objective type questions may include questions with one word to one sentence answer/fill in the blank/true or false/multiple choice type questions/Numerical questions. 1*11=11
Question no 2 to 3 will carry 2 marks each question (out of which 1 questions will be theoretical and 1 numerical). Answer to each question should be in about 30-35 words. 2*2=4
Question no 4 Consist of 3 subparts (i-iii) out of which 1 questions will be Numerical and 1 will be theoretical. (Attempt any 2 questions out of 3) .Each question will carry 4 marks Answer to the theoretical should be in about 60-70 words. 2*4=8
Question no 5 consists of 3 theoretical subparts (i-iii) (Attempt any 2 questions out of 3) Each question will carry 6 marks Answer to the theoretical questions should be in about 150-200 words. 2*6=12
Section B.
Question No 6 consist of 6 subparts (a to f) carrying 1 mark each. Objective type questions may include questions with one word to one sentence answer/fill in the blank/true or false/multiple choice type questions/Numerical questions. 1*6=6
Question no 7 to 9 will carry 2 marks each, out of which 1 question will be theoretical and 2 numerical. Answer to the theoretical question should be in about 30-35 words. 3*2=6
Question no 10 Consist of 4 subparts (i-iv) out of which 2 questions will be Numerical and 2 will be theoretical. (Attempt any 3 questions out of 4) .Each question will carry 4 marks Answer to the theoretical should be in about 60-70 words. 3*4=12
Question no 11, Attempt 1 question out of 2. Out of which 1 will be numerical and 1 will be theoretical Each question will carry 6 marks Answer to the theoretical questions should be in about 150- 200 words. 2*6=12
Section C
Question No. 12 consists of 3 subparts (a to c) carrying 1 mark each. Objective type questions may include questions with one word to one sentence answer/fill in the blank/true or false/multiple choice type questions/Numerical questions. 1*3=3
Question no 13 will carry 2 marks, attempt 1 out of 2 questions. Answer to each question should be in about 30-35 words. 1*2=2
Question no 14 will carry 4 marks (Attempt any 1 questions out of 2). Each question will carry 4 marks Answer should be in about 60-70 words. 1*4=4
Question no 15 consists of 2 subparts (i-ii) consist of theoretical questions (Attempt any 1 questions out of 2) Each question will carry 6 marks Answer to the theoretical questions should be in about 150- 200 words. 1*6=6
